// Maximum prefetch window (in stops) for the Hallwren audio-guide app.
// New contractors: this controls how many upcoming exhibit narrations are
// downloaded while the visitor walks the gallery. The Marrowfield Museum
// pilot showed that anything above 4 saturates their shared Wi-Fi during
// school-group hours, so raise this only with curator sign-off. Offline
// packs bypass this limit entirely. The value below was tuned against
// the following build.

trace token, tawep-fahif: htk3_b58

**Key Ceremony Checklist — Item 7: Hermetic Build Migration (Tarnwood CI)**

Reviewer: confirm the Glasswren build has been fully migrated to the Hermeton hermetic build system before signing. Verify that no network fetches occur during compilation, that all toolchain archives are pinned by digest, and that the reproducibility check passed twice on the Ashgate runners. Once satisfied, countersign the ceremony log and unseal the signing token. The token's recovery material is restored by entering the phrase that appears below.

strongbox words: norwyn-wenael-aldvan-aldiel-wendor-holael

Handover — canary gating, from Melwin to Orsa. Gating rules for the Plover deploy pipeline now block promotion when error rate or latency deltas breach thresholds over a ten-minute window. Rollback is automatic; no manual approval needed below stage three. Nothing pending except the metrics backfill. The gating service runs with the following configuration.

deployment values, yadug-bawif:
[framir]
team = pelox
access_code = ac_a38ab2
owner = tamion.julael
host = framir.tolvaqlabs.test
port = 11211
peer = tammir.zemvargrid.local
salt = 2215ef03
pin = 1541